abstract:# 连接数据库 function connect($db){ $conn = @mysqli_connect($db['host'], $db['user'], $db['pass'], $db['name']); &
# 连接数据库 function connect($db){ $conn = @mysqli_connect($db['host'], $db['user'], $db['pass'], $db['name']); if(!$conn){ # 连接错误, 抛出异常 exit('数据库错误:'.mysqli_connect_error()); } return $conn; } # 统计数量 function count_number($db, $table, $where){ $sql = "SELECT COUNT(*) AS count_number FROM ".$table." WHERE ".$where; $return = mysqli_query($db, $sql); $row = mysqli_fetch_assoc($return); return $row['count_number']; } # 查询单个数据 function find_one($db, $table, $filed, $where){ $sql = "SELECT " .$filed. " FROM ".$table. " WHERE " .$where." LIMIT 1"; $return = mysqli_query($db, $sql); $row = mysqli_fetch_assoc($return); return $row; } # 查询单条数据 function find($db, $table, $where, $order){ $sql = "SELECT * FROM ".$table. " WHERE " .$where; if($order){ $sql .= ' ORDER BY '.$order; } $sql .= " LIMIT 1 "; $return = mysqli_query($db, $sql); $row = mysqli_fetch_assoc($return); return $row; } function select($db, $sql){ $return = mysqli_query($db, $sql); if($return){ while ($row = mysqli_fetch_assoc($return)){ $rows[] = $row; } } return $rows; } function insert($db, $sql){ $return = mysqli_query($db, $sql); if($return){ $return = mysqli_insert_id($db); } return $return; } function update($db, $sql){ $return = mysqli_query($db, $sql); return $return; } function delete($db, $sql){ $return = mysqli_query($db, $sql); return $return; } # 关闭数据库 mysqli_close($db);
Correcting teacher:天蓬老师Correction time:2018-12-11 14:28:58
Teacher's summary:非常完整, 每个步骤都很规范,坚持 加油